Everton boss David Moyes speaks on the future of Dominic Calvert Lewin and other ongoing contract talks ahead of their Premier League clash with Ipswich

00:43One player that has been highlighted is Dominic Calvert-Lewin
00:45and that potentially he's decided that he would like to stay on Merseyside.
00:49Has he given any indication to you that that's what he's feeling at the moment?
00:53Well, I think the way the team's playing and the goals we're scoring, the chances we're making
00:57will give Dom a lot more hope that he wants to try and work his way back to the top again.
01:03And by doing that, he needs to score goals of assists
01:05and I think that the team might be able to give him something like that.
01:08So, he's part of that group of players who are coming out of contract
01:12who we'll discuss with and see how things go in the coming weeks.
01:16Is there any extra detail you can give?
01:18Because we know there's been a contract offer on the table.
01:20Has there been a renewal of that?
01:22Has there been anything different as regards to coaching?
01:24Well, I can say there's not been a contract offer on the table since I've been here, Vinny.
01:27I think the contract offer was here under a different regime.
01:31So, we want everybody to have to fight for what they're doing.
01:34They have to show what they're worth.
01:37So, there's a lot of that way.
01:38We're taking a little bit of time to look at it.
01:40We've not had loads of times in January, but we've had some time.
01:44Unfortunately, Dom's been injured for a big part of it.
01:46But Dom's history has been very good.
01:49So, obviously, we'll be taking all that into consideration.
